A number of psychological and physical factors contribute to erectile dysfunction. Cardiovascular disease, diabetes, neurological disorders, stress, and anxiety are just a few of the potential contributors to ED. Although commonly related to older men, ED can affect males of any age, making it a major issue for men’s overall health.

Limitations of conventional ED treatments

Traditionally, oral medications known as phosphodiesterase type 5 (PDE5) inhibitors have been the go-to solution for erectile dysfunction. These drugs, while effective for some men, come with certain drawbacks. They may not work for everyone, lead to adverse reactions, and fail to target the root causes of ED. Moreover, the need to take these medications prior to sexual activity hinders spontaneity and impacts the overall experience.

Mechanisms of shockwave therapy

Low-intensity extracorporeal shockwave therapy (LI-ESWT), commonly referred to as shockwave therapy, is a revolutionary treatment that harnesses the power of acoustic waves to promote healing and regeneration in the penis. The therapy involves applying a specialized probe to the penis, which emits focused, low-intensity sound waves. These waves trigger a series of biological reactions, including:

  • Enhanced blood flow – Shockwaves stimulate the formation of new blood vessels (angiogenesis) and improve circulation within the penis.
  • Nerve tissue regeneration – The therapy may aid in the regeneration and repair of damaged nerve endings, leading to improved sensitivity and function.
  • Stem cell activation – Shockwaves stimulate dormant stem cells in the penis to become active, which facilitates the healing process.

A growing body of evidence

Although shockwave therapy is a relatively recent development in the realm of ED treatment, an increasing amount of research supports its effectiveness and safety. Numerous studies have demonstrated that LI-ESWT leads to the improvement of vasculogenic ED, which is caused by inadequate blood flow. An in-depth meta-analysis published in the Journal of Sexual Medicine in 2019 found that LI-ESWT is effective for ED.

Unique pros of shockwave therapy

Shockwave therapy offers several distinct advantages over traditional ED treatments:

  • Potential for long-term results – Unlike oral medications that provide short-term effects, shockwave therapy aims to restore natural erectile function, potentially offering long-lasting improvements.
  • Minimally invasive and medication-free – Shockwave therapy is a non-surgical procedure that doesn’t require injections or medication, making it an attractive option for men who prefer a more holistic approach.
  • No recovery time – The procedure usually takes around 30 minutes. Men can resume their normal activities, including sexual activity, immediately following the treatment.
